Oman
Cardiff Metropolitan has had a close friendship with Oman for a number of years. We have over 50 Omani students at the University and particularly popular subjects include Biomedical Science, Food Science, Business and IT, MBA and Tourism.
We have an Oman Society and Muslim prayer rooms on our campuses. Every year, Omani students celebrate their National Day at Cardiff Metropolitan and also hold celebrations on religious festivals such as Eid.
In addition to regular marketing visits to Oman, the International Office always attend the GHEDEX Exhibitions which are held at the SEEB Exhibition Centre every April. The University also has a memorandum of understanding with Sultan Qaboos University.
Cardiff Met Entry Requirements
Students who have the following qualifications may be considered for direct entry onto relevant schemes at Cardiff Metropolitan University:
Foundation Courses
Students who hold the Thanawihama from Oman
Undergraduate Courses
Students who hold a recognised Foundation Diploma.
OR students who have taken a Diploma or Advanced Diploma level course in Oman.
OR students with significant work experience in a related field.
PLEASE NOTE! Students with Advanced Diploma and work experience may be considered for Advanced Standing Entry
Postgraduate Courses
Students with a good Bachelors Degree from SQU.
OR students with a good Bachelors Degree from a university in the UK.
OR students with a good Bachelors Degree from a recognised university in the Middle East.
